Sound Point Meridian Capital Inc. 8.00% Series A Preferred Shares Due 2029 (SPMA) is trading at $25.21 as of 2026-04-20, posting a 0.52% gain in recent trading sessions. As a preferred share issuance, SPMA blends fixed-income characteristics including a set 8.00% annual coupon and stated 2029 maturity with exchange-traded equity liquidity, making it a common holding for income-focused retail and institutional investors.
